Brown suffers broken wrist

Hereford United's loanee Wayne Brown has broken his wrist and now faces a number of months on the sidelines. Graham Turner said, speaking to the Official Hereford United website, that there is work all ready going on to bring in a short term replacement for the 'keeper on a seasons long loan from Chester.

Craig Mawson will now keep his place in goal for The Bulls, which he has had in the last few games, mostly due to the terms in Brown's loan deal, which don't allow him to play in cup games whilst at Edgar Street. Mawson suprisingly kept his starting place for the home game against Woking last Saturday but is now, almost, guaranteed of a start at Dagenham tomorrow. It is thought that youngster Carl Lewis will be United's sub goalie for the encounter.
